Предмет: Информатика,
автор: Dad51
Вася подсчитал сумму цифр натурального числа N , а затем сумму цифр у полученной суммы цифр. Какое число он получил?
Входные данные
Вводится одно натуральное число N , меньшее 10 000 .
Выходные данные
Выведите одно натуральное число — ответ в задаче.
НУЖНО СДЕЛАТЬ НА PASCAL ABC
Ответы
Автор ответа:
0
var n,s:integer;
begin
readln(n);
s:=0;
while n>0 do
begin
s:=s+n mod 10;
n:=n div 10;
end;
writeln(s div 10 + s mod 10);
end.
Пример:
4093
7
begin
readln(n);
s:=0;
while n>0 do
begin
s:=s+n mod 10;
n:=n div 10;
end;
writeln(s div 10 + s mod 10);
end.
Пример:
4093
7
Похожие вопросы
Предмет: Алгебра,
автор: wuzert8896
Предмет: Алгебра,
автор: polina20203
Предмет: Алгебра,
автор: petlitsky7950
Предмет: Литература,
автор: Anahit2007
Предмет: Українська література,
автор: grizuknastya